Marriage to William Russell

Rose Swisher first met William Russell while they were both studying at the University of San Francisco. Russell was a physical education student, and Swisher was pursuing her nursing degree.

They fell in love with each other, and their relationship blossomed into a beautiful union. Swisher and Russell got married, and they were blessed with three children during their marriage Karen, William, and Jacob.

William Russell was undoubtedly one of the best basketball players of his time, and his fame and success in the sport resulted in a lot of attention from the media and his fans. Swisher was devoted to her husband and supported him throughout his career by attending his games, cheering him on, and offering him emotional support when he needed it most.

Unfortunately, after many years of marriage, Swisher and Russell went through a difficult separation that ended in divorce in 1973. Swisher went on to lead a private life, focusing on her career as a photographer and philanthropic work.
